Abstract

Intense accumulation of radioactivity during 67Ga-citrate scanning was observed in the leg of a patient with advanced mycosis fungoides after repeated radiotherapy and chemotherapy. Infiltration of the calf muscle by neoplastic lymphoid cells was confirmed at autopsy. Radionuclide visualization of an uncommon involvement of the skeletal muscle by the disease has not been previously reported.
